Notice of AGM
Kodal Minerals (AIM: KOD), the West African lithium producer, mineral exploration and development company, announces that the Company's annual general meeting ("AGM") will be held at 11:00am on Wednesday 24 June 2026 at the offices of Fieldfisher LLP, 9th Floor, Riverbank House, 2 Swan Lane, London EC4R 3TT. The AGM notice will be made available on the Company's website www.kodalminerals.com shortly.
Despite the best efforts of all parties, further time is required to complete the audit of the consolidated accounts of the Company's associated undertaking, Kodal Mining UK Limited, including its Malian subsidiary Les Mines de Lithium de Bougouni SA, the owner and operator of the Bougouni Lithium Project. Accordingly, the Group's audited accounts for the nine months ended 31 December 2025 have not yet been finalised. Therefore, the resolutions to receive the annual report and accounts as well as to put the Company's remuneration report to an advisory vote will not be put to shareholders at the AGM.
The Company expects the audited accounts to be published prior to the date of the AGM and will convene a further general meeting for shareholders in due course to receive the audited annual report and accounts as well as to put the Company's remuneration report to an advisory vote.

About Kodal Minerals
Kodal Minerals plc, the AIM-quoted West African lithium explorer, developer and producer, is the co-developer of its flagship Bougouni Lithium Project in Southern Mali alongside its partner Hainan Mining Co. Ltd, a subsidiary of Hong Kong-listed Fosun International.
The Bougouni Lithium Project covers 350km² in the world-class Birimian terrain of West Africa, located approximately 180km south of Mali's capital Bamako. The Stage 1 Dense Media Separation ('DMS') processing plant achieved first spodumene concentrate production in February 2025 and made its first shipment of concentrate in December 2025. A Stage 2 Flotation plant is planned in future years to process the finer-grained resources within the Bougouni deposit.
Bougouni is operated by Les Mines de Lithium de Bougouni SA ('LMLB'), a subsidiary of Kodal Mining UK Limited ('KMUK') which owns the project and in which Kodal has a 49 per cent shareholding.
The Company also has an early-stage gold asset in its diverse portfolio located in West Africa.
